New poetry, commentary, and even a manifesto or two will feature in this evening with three heavy-hitting Canadian writers. John Barton, Victoria’s Poet Laureate, gathers his most provocative essays, public lectures, and reviews in We Are Not Avatars, a collection 25 years in the making. Meanwhile, David Eso looks back on the work of Robert Kroetsch in Post-glacial, his selection of poems from the postmodern master. And Miranda Pearson goes on a journey in Rail, which tracks the English-Canadian diaspora through its thoughtful, subversive poems. Enjoy a multifaceted event that’s sure to inform and inspire.
